Document Description
The project proposes to develop a 4-year University campus, campus support uses and Innovation District on approximately 380 acres of land located within the City's Eastern University District, specifically the University Focus Area. The proposed University and Innovation District project is comprised of the following University and campus support uses to be implemented over its phased buildout: academic space and supporting uses, physical education/recreation/athletics uses, student support space, campus housing, research-based industrial park/commercial uses, parking lots/structures and open space. The campus would be designed to ultimately serve a population of 20,000 full-time equivalent students supported by approximately 6,000 faculty and staff. Potential amendments to the Chula Vista General Plan and/or General Development Plans for Otay Ranch and Eastlake III may be required to implement the proposed project, including but not limited to the Circulation Element of the General Plan and policy language pertaining to the University Focus Area in the Otay Ranch GDP and Eastlake III GDP. A Tentative Map will also be processed.
